一、怎么判断源码是否完整?
可以去官网查询源码是否有注册就可以知道是否完整了
二、网页聊天源码 java
在如今信息技术飞速发展的时代,网页聊天已成为人们日常生活中不可或缺的一部分。这种即时通讯方式为人们带来了极大的便利性,不仅可以加强社交联系,还可以提高工作效率。而要实现网页聊天功能,除了优秀的前端设计外,后端的代码也至关重要。今天我们将介绍如何使用网页聊天源码 Java来实现一个功能强大的网页聊天系统。
为什么选择 Java 作为后端语言?
Java作为一种成熟且稳定的编程语言,拥有强大的生态系统和广泛的应用领域,是开发网络应用的绝佳选择。其优秀的跨平台性和强大的并发处理能力使得 Java 在开发网页聊天系统时表现出色。
网页聊天源码 Java 实现步骤
- 准备工作:在开始编写代码之前,确保你已经安装了适当版本的 Java 开发环境,并且了解基本的网络编程知识。
- 创建项目:使用 Eclipse、IntelliJ IDEA等集成开发环境创建一个新的 Java 项目,并配置好所需的依赖项。
- 设计数据库:一个完善的网页聊天系统需要一个高效的数据库设计。使用 MySQL或PostgreSQL等数据库管理系统创建用户表、聊天记录表等。
- 编写后端代码:使用网页聊天源码 Java编写后端代码,实现用户认证、消息发送接收等核心功能。确保代码结构清晰、可扩展性强。
- 前端页面设计:设计美观、易用的前端页面以展示网页聊天功能。使用 、CSS和JavaScript等技术实现页面布局和交互效果。
- 前后端通信:通过 Ajax、WebSocket等技术实现前后端的实时通信。确保消息快速、稳定地传输。
- 测试与优化:在完成网页聊天系统后进行全面测试,并根据用户反馈和性能测试结果进行优化,提升系统的稳定性和用户体验。
优秀网页聊天系统的特点
一个优秀的网页聊天系统应该具备以下特点:
- 安全性:系统需要提供安全的用户认证机制和消息加密机制,确保用户信息的安全性。
- 稳定性:系统需要具备良好的容错能力和稳定性,确保用户可以随时随地进行聊天。
- 可扩展性:系统需要具备良好的扩展性,能够支持大量用户同时在线聊天。
- 用户体验:系统需要设计友好的用户界面和交互方式,提高用户的使用体验。
结语
通过本文的介绍,相信大家对使用网页聊天源码 Java来实现网页聊天系统有了更深入的了解。在开发过程中,不仅需要注意功能的实现,也要注重系统的安全性和稳定性。希望这些经验能够帮助你顺利开发出功能强大的网页聊天系统,为用户提供更好的聊天体验。
三、鸿蒙源码讲解完整版?
华为的鸿蒙系统开源之后第一个想看的模块就是 FS 模块,想了解一下它的 IO 路径与 linux 的区别。现在鸿蒙开源的仓库中有两个内核系统,一个是 liteos_a 系统,一个是 liteos_m 系统。两者的区别主要是适应的场景不一样,liteos_a 系统适用于硬件资源更加丰富的场景,比如 CPU 更强,内存更大;而 liteos_m 系统则适用于 IoT 设备,相对来说硬件资源比较弱一些。所以我们就拿 liteos_a 系统来分析一下它的 IO 栈吧,毕竟它应对的场景更加复杂一些。
四、php网页源码完整
PHP网页源码完整引入SEO优化
随着互联网的发展,网站已经成为企业展示和推广的重要途径之一。而要让人们能够更容易地找到和访问这些网站,SEO(搜索引擎优化)就显得尤为重要。在网站开发过程中,合理的代码结构和内容优化不仅能提升用户体验,还能有助于网站在搜索引擎中的排名。本文将介绍如何在编写PHP网页源码时,有效地进行SEO优化,提升网站的曝光度和流量。
首先,对于一个PHP网页源码而言,完整性至关重要。确保每个页面的代码都是完整的,没有遗漏或错误。
其次,php 网页源码的结构和格式也需要注意。良好的代码结构不仅有助于搜索引擎更好地理解网页内容,还能降低页面加载时间,提升用户体验。在编写PHP源码时,应尽量避免嵌套过深的标签结构,简洁明了的代码更容易被搜索引擎抓取和分析。
除了代码结构外,关键词的合理运用也是影响网页排名的重要因素。在编写PHP网页源码时,应该根据页面内容选择合适的关键词,并将其完整地融入到标题、段落和链接文本中。同时,还要注意不要过度使用关键词,以免被搜索引擎视为作弊行为而进行惩罚。
对于网页中的图片和多媒体内容,也要注意php网页源码的完整性。为每个图片添加合适的alt属性,不仅有助于搜索引擎理解图片内容,还能提升网页的可访问性。此外,对于包含视频或音频的页面,应该提供相应的文字说明,帮助搜索引擎更好地索引这些内容。
另外,在编写PHP网页源码时,应该注意网页的速度优化。页面加载速度是搜索引擎排名的重要指标之一,过长的加载时间会降低用户体验,影响网站的流量和转化率。通过压缩代码、优化图片大小、合理使用缓存等手段,可以有效提升网页加载速度,从而提升网站的SEO表现。
此外,对于动态生成的php网页源码,也可以通过静态化处理来提升SEO效果。将页面静态化可以减少服务器的负载,加快页面响应速度,同时也有利于搜索引擎抓取和索引页面内容。可以考虑使用缓存技术或静态页面生成工具来实现网站页面的静态化处理。
总的来说,对于PHP网页源码的完整性和优化是提升网站SEO效果的重要环节。通过合理的代码结构、关键词运用、图片多媒体优化和页面速度优化等手段,可以有效提升网站在搜索引擎中的排名,吸引更多的用户访问和点击,为网站的发展提供有力支持。
五、打造高效便捷的PHP聊天室——完整源码+详细分析
引言
在当今互联网时代,聊天室成为人们交流的重要工具之一。而PHP作为一种广泛应用的编程语言,有着便捷、灵活等优势,逐渐成为开发聊天室的首选。本文将详细介绍如何使用PHP语言构建一个高效、便捷的聊天室,并附上完整源码及详细分析。
1. 功能需求分析
在开始构建聊天室之前,我们需要明确聊天室的功能需求。一个基本的聊天室通常具备以下功能:
- 用户注册与登录:用户可以通过注册账号获取聊天室的访问权限,登录账号后才能进行聊天。
- 消息发送与接收:用户可以发送消息并实时接收其他用户的消息。
- 在线用户列表:聊天室可以显示当前在线的用户列表,方便用户选择私聊对象。
- 私聊功能:用户可以选择某个在线用户进行私聊,保护隐私。
- 消息记录:聊天室会保存历史消息记录,方便用户回溯。
2. 架构设计
基于以上功能需求,我们可以设计出一个简单的聊天室架构:
- 前端界面:使用HTML、CSS和JavaScript构建用户界面,发送和接收消息通过AJAX实时更新。
- 后端:使用PHP进行逻辑处理,包括用户注册登录验证、消息发送接收、在线用户管理等。
- 数据存储:使用MySQL数据库保存用户信息和消息记录。
3. 编码实现
基于以上架构设计,我们可以开始编码实现聊天室。以下是主要的实现步骤:
- 创建数据库:在MySQL中创建一个新的数据库,用于保存用户信息和消息记录。
- 编写前端界面:使用HTML、CSS和JavaScript构建聊天室的用户界面,实现消息发送和接收的功能。
- 编写后端逻辑:使用PHP编写后端逻辑,包括用户注册登录验证、消息发送接收、在线用户管理等功能。
- 与数据库交互:使用PHP连接MySQL数据库,实现用户信息和消息记录的存储与读取。
- 部署与测试:将前端界面和后端代码部署到服务器上,进行测试,修复可能存在的bug。
4. 源码分析
为了帮助读者更好地理解聊天室的实现过程,本文提供了完整的聊天室源码并进行了详细的分析。读者可以通过对源码的研究,深入了解聊天室的实现原理和关键代码的解析。
结语
通过本文的介绍,读者可以了解到如何使用PHP构建一个高效、便捷的聊天室。同时,通过对源码的分析,读者也可以深入理解聊天室的实现原理和关键代码。希望本文对读者在开发聊天室方面有所帮助。
感谢您耐心阅读本文,希望本文能为您提供一些有价值的信息。如有任何问题或建议,请随时与我们联系。
六、java聊天程序图形界面源码
在软件开发领域中,Java是一种广泛应用的编程语言,其强大的跨平台特性使其成为程序员们钟爱的选择。今天,我们将探讨如何使用Java编写一个聊天程序,并为其添加图形界面以提升用户体验。以下是我们提供的Java聊天程序图形界面源码。
第一步:创建GUI
首先,我们需要创建程序的图形用户界面(GUI)。在Java中,可以使用Swing或JavaFX等库来建立界面。我们建议使用Swing库,因为它简单易用,适合初学者。
第二步:连接服务器
聊天程序需要连接服务器以实现消息传递功能。我们可以使用Socket套接字来建立客户端和服务器之间的通信。确保在程序中包含适当的异常处理代码,以应对网络连接可能出现的问题。
第三步:实现消息传递
为了让用户能够发送和接收消息,我们需要在程序中添加消息传递的功能。通过Socket套接字,可以轻松地实现消息的发送和接收。同时,为了提高用户体验,可以考虑添加消息的时间戳和发送者信息。
第四步:设计界面布局
界面布局在用户体验中起着至关重要的作用。设计一个清晰、直观的界面能够让用户更容易地使用程序。确保界面元素的排版合理,以便用户可以轻松地找到并使用各种功能。
第五步:美化界面
除了功能性布局外,美化界面也是提升用户体验的关键。添加一些图标、颜色和动画效果可以让程序看起来更加吸引人。在设计界面时,要注重整体风格的统一性,避免过多花哨的元素影响用户体验。
第六步:测试与调试
在完成程序的开发后,务必进行全面的测试与调试工作。测试可以帮助发现潜在的bug和问题,及时修复以确保程序的稳定性和可靠性。同时,用户体验也会受到测试的影响,因此要注重细节和交互流畅度。
第七步:发布与部署
最后一步是将程序发布并部署到用户手中。可以选择将程序打包成可执行文件或安装包进行发布,以便用户能够方便地下载和安装。同时,确保程序的安全性和稳定性,以提供良好的用户体验。
通过以上步骤,我们成功地创建了一个Java聊天程序,并为其添加了图形界面以增强用户体验。希望这份源码对你有所帮助,也欢迎进行个性化的定制和优化,以满足特定的需求和期望。
七、使用PHP开发聊天功能的源码
简介
在当今社交网络泛滥的时代,聊天功能成为了各种网站和应用程序中必不可少的一部分。无论是在线客服系统、社交平台还是实时通信工具,聊天功能都是增强用户互动和提供即时通讯的重要手段。本文将介绍如何使用PHP开发一个简单但功能强大的聊天功能,为网站或应用程序增添交流和互动的价值。
聊天功能的需求
在开发聊天功能之前,我们首先需要明确聊天功能的需求。根据不同的场景和目的,聊天功能的需求会有所不同。主要的需求包括:
- 实时通信:聊天功能需要支持实时消息的传递,用户之间能够实时地发送和接收消息。
- 多种消息类型:聊天功能需要支持文本消息、图片、音频、视频等多种消息类型的发送和接收。
- 用户身份认证:聊天功能需要对用户进行身份认证,确保只有合法用户可以使用聊天功能。
- 聊天历史记录:聊天功能需要保存聊天消息的历史记录,用户可以查看以前的聊天记录。
- 用户状态管理:聊天功能需要支持用户在线状态的管理,包括用户上线、下线等。
使用PHP开发聊天功能的步骤
下面将介绍使用PHP开发聊天功能的步骤:
1. 创建数据库
首先,我们需要创建一个数据库来存储聊天消息的相关信息。数据库中可以包括用户表、消息表、在线用户表等。
2. 用户身份认证
在聊天功能中,用户需要先进行身份认证才能使用聊天功能。可以使用用户名和密码进行认证,也可以使用第三方身份认证方式,如OAuth等。
3. 实时通信
使用PHP和其他前端技术(如JavaScript)来实现实时通信的功能。可以使用WebSocket、long polling等技术实现实时消息的传递。
4. 多种消息类型的支持
聊天功能应该支持多种消息类型的发送和接收。可以使用文件上传功能来支持图片、音频、视频等消息类型的发送。
5. 聊天历史记录的保存
为了方便用户查看以前的聊天记录,聊天功能需要保存聊天消息的历史记录。可以将聊天记录存储在数据库中。
6. 用户状态管理
聊天功能需要支持用户在线状态的管理。可以使用心跳机制来检测用户是否在线,也可以使用定时任务来更新在线用户列表。
总结
通过使用PHP开发聊天功能,我们可以为网站或应用程序增加交流和互动的价值。无论是创建在线客服系统、社交平台还是实现实时通信工具,通过开发聊天功能,我们可以满足用户的需求,提升用户体验。
感谢您阅读本文,希望通过本文的介绍,您对使用PHP开发聊天功能有了更深入的了解,并能够在实践中灵活运用。
八、有什么网站上有app项目的完整源码。?
GitHub 路 Build software better, together.Google Code其实更常见的不是在搜索类似项目的时候找到托管在各个网站上的开源项目么
顺带从第一个可以看出- -知乎没处理好编码问题,和百度一样
九、如何获取和使用Android聊天软件源码
引言
在移动应用市场中,聊天软件一直是最受欢迎的应用之一。随着智能手机的普及和人们对社交网络的依赖,越来越多的开发者希望能够创建自己的聊天应用。然而,从零开始开发一个稳定、功能齐全的聊天软件是一项复杂的任务,这就是为什么很多开发者会寻找现有的聊天软件源码来加速开发过程的原因。
获取聊天软件源码
首先,你需要通过一些途径获取合适的Android聊天软件源码。有几个常见的渠道可以供你选择:
- 开源社区:像GitHub这样的开源社区是开发者分享源代码的热门平台。你可以在上面找到许多开源的聊天软件源码。
- 第三方市场:一些第三方市场提供了免费或者付费的聊天软件源码。你可以通过搜索关键词来找到适合你需求的源码。
- 开发者论坛:有些开发者论坛有专门的板块用于分享和交流源码。你可以在这些论坛的源码板块上寻找聊天软件的源码。
选择合适的源码
在获取到一些源码之后,你需要认真比较和评估它们,以选择合适的源码。以下几个因素值得考虑:
- 功能齐全:源码应该包含你所需的基本功能,比如聊天、发送图片、语音通话等。
- 稳定性:源码应该是经过测试和维护的,确保在各种设备和平台上都能正常运行。
- 易于定制:源码应该易于定制和扩展,以适应你的特定需求。
- 支持和文档:源码提供者应该提供相应的支持和文档,以帮助你理解和使用源码。
- 价格:如果你选择的源码需要付费,你需要考虑它的价格是否合理。
使用聊天软件源码
一旦你选择了合适的源码,你可以按照以下步骤开始使用它:
- 下载源码:根据源码提供者的要求,下载源码到你的电脑。
- 解压源码:使用解压软件将源码文件解压到你的工作目录。
- 导入项目:使用Android开发工具(如Android Studio)导入源码项目。
- 配置依赖:根据源码提供的文档,配置所需的依赖关系。
- 定制和扩展:根据你的需求,对源码进行定制和扩展。
- 测试和部署:在真机或者模拟器上测试你的应用,并根据需要部署到移动设备上。
结论
使用现有的聊天软件源码可以大大加速你的开发过程,并且能够确保你的应用具备稳定的功能。以下是一些额外的建议:
- 阅读源码:在开始定制和扩展之前,确保你对源码的结构和实现细节有一定的了解。
- 参与社区:如果你遇到问题或者需要帮助,可以加入相关的开发者社区寻求帮助和交流经验。
- 保持更新:随着技术的发展,你需要时刻关注源码的更新和新功能的添加。及时更新你的应用以保持竞争力。
感谢您阅读本文,希望通过本文对获取和使用Android聊天软件源码有所帮助。
十、java聊天完整app
构建一个完整的Java聊天应用程序
在当今快节奏的数字世界中,即时通讯已经成为人们生活中不可或缺的一部分。为了满足用户对稳定、安全和功能丰富的聊天应用程序的需求,我们可以借助Java编程语言来构建一个完整的聊天应用程序。本文将为您介绍如何使用Java编程语言开发一个功能完善的聊天应用程序。
项目概述
首先,让我们来了解一下我们即将开发的Java聊天应用程序的主要功能和特点:
- 实时消息传递
- 用户认证和权限管理
- 群聊和私聊功能
- 消息记录和存储
- 界面友好,用户体验良好
通过实现以上功能,我们将开发一个功能完善且适用于各种场景的Java聊天应用程序。
技术栈
在开发Java聊天应用程序时,我们将使用以下技术栈:
- Java编程语言
- Socket编程
- Swing GUI库
- MySQL数据库
通过结合这些强大的技术,我们可以实现一个高效、稳定且功能强大的聊天应用程序。
功能实现
接下来,让我们重点关注如何实现Java聊天应用程序的各项功能:
实时消息传递
实现实时消息传递功能是Java聊天应用程序的核心功能之一。通过使用Socket编程,我们可以建立客户端和服务器之间的通信通道,实现用户之间的实时消息传递。通过定义消息协议和数据格式,确保消息的准确传递和解析。
用户认证和权限管理
为了保证聊天应用程序的安全性,我们需要实现用户认证和权限管理功能。通过使用MySQL数据库存储用户信息和权限设置,确保用户登录时的身份验证以及权限控制的有效性。同时,结合Swing GUI库设计友好的用户界面,让用户能够方便地管理自己的账户和权限。
群聊和私聊功能
除了基本的一对一聊天功能外,群聊和私聊功能也是Java聊天应用程序必不可少的部分。通过设计合适的聊天界面和聊天室管理机制,实现用户之间的群聊和私聊功能。确保用户可以灵活地选择与多人聊天还是私下交流。
消息记录和存储
为了方便用户查看历史消息和管理聊天记录,我们需要实现消息记录和存储功能。通过将用户的聊天记录存储在数据库中,并设计合适的查询接口和数据展示形式,实现用户可以方便地查看和管理自己的消息记录。
界面友好,用户体验良好
最后,要实现一个成功的Java聊天应用程序,界面友好和用户体验是至关重要的。通过设计简洁清晰的用户界面,结合醒目的功能按钮和信息展示,让用户可以方便地使用和操作聊天应用程序,提升用户体验。
总结
通过本文的介绍,您现在应该对如何使用Java编程语言构建一个完整的聊天应用程序有了更深入的了解。通过合理规划项目功能和技术栈,并注重细节的实现,我们可以开发出一个稳定、功能丰富且用户体验良好的Java聊天应用程序。希望本文对您有所帮助,祝您开发顺利!
- 相关评论
- 我要评论
-